green sauce

A delicious chimichurri recipe

Chimichurri is a condiment I simply cannot live without. I used to buy a fantastic green sauce from a local South American cook who sold…

peas with salsa verde

I made a very big batch of this tasty green sauce because I had bags of fresh herbs left over from a shoot. This is…